Roseville Area Schools recognizes that some students have outstanding abilities that differ from other students of their age, experience and environment. The Gifted and Talented Education (GATE) Program seeks to identify these students in order to provide services and programming to meet their unique needs, while providing rigor, challenge and an enriched learning environment for all students.
